... Read moreBuilding an emotional connection is essential for nurturing intimate relationships. The foundation of any strong partnership lies in communication, trust, and mutual understanding. Without emotional intimacy, physical connections can feel shallow or disconnected. Establishing that emotional link involves actively listening to your partner, sharing personal experiences, and being vulnerable with one another. Encourage open discussions about feelings, fears, and aspirations, as this will enhance the bond you share. Emotional intimacy fosters a sense of safety and security, making both partners feel valued and loved. Understanding each other on a deeper level will ultimately lead to a more fulfilling physical connection. Additionally, consider engaging in shared activities or experiences that allow both of you to explore emotions and create memories. Activities such as couples' therapy, date nights, or group classes can help stimulate conversation and connection. Remember, establishing that deeper emotional connection may take time, but the rewards are worth the effort. When both partners feel heard, appreciated, and connected emotionally, the physical aspect of the relationship can flourish.
